BERLIN AIRLIFT REVISTED The Joint Services Open House at Andrews Air Force Base, Md., this weekend will pay tribute to the pilots of the Berlin Airlift as the 60th anniversary of the historic supply effort approaches in June. In this image, C-47 transport planes, each containing 190 sacks of flour, are shown arriving at Tempelhof Airport, July 2, 1948. A pair of B-17 weather aircraft can be seen at the far side of the airfield along with a lone C-54 at the extreme right.
